A change of pace from the usual Yamaguchirow K/K-- this doujinshi is still based on Rurouni Kenshin; in fact, it's the first RK (or indeed any) doujinshi I ever bought. When I got it, I was fairly new to RK and Viz hadn't even licensed the English-language version of the original manga yet, so I only knew the vague outlines of the Jinchuu Arc although I was already developing a crush on Enishi. So at the time, while I knew this Enishi/Kaoru story was likely to be somewhat noncanonical, I wasn't really sure how much it diverged.

As it turns out, rather a lot. Instead of the Six Comrades and Wu Heishin, Enishi has a support staff of other bishounen (a few of them have cameos at the beginning of this story, but there's a much larger cast involved in a complex drama throughout several more doujinshi by this circle). I don't have a good idea who they are, but there's a lengthy preface which might need to be translated as well to give a better idea of what's going on and why.

The general style is significantly different from Yamaguchirow-- instead of Kaoru having voluptuous boobage despite everyone's chibi-esque body proportions, the character designs here are long and lean. Facial expressions are somewhat more limited, and tend toward cool elegance rather than sweaty passions. The sexual content is also much less explicit, both in terms of detail and general presentation. And jeez, there's a lot of (small blurry) kanji in the first few pages-- Lenz uses kanji for a lot of common words which Yamaguchi usually leaves in kana.
